switched to the i810 driver, but screen still won't go above 800x600.
what file is causing this? tried using enlightenment, blackbox, and
gnome. none will go to 1024x768???
thanks again
only thing I can think of is that your monitor settings aren't right. I
had similar problems for a while with my envision en-710e. my horiz sync
and vert refresh ranges weren't right and consequently it couldn't get a
good set-up for the higher res. I adjusted those numbers to some
conservative ranges that fit the monitor specs and problem solved.
youmight check the monitor specs and see if you can make that work. be
conservative soyou don't fry the monitor.
